Abstract

The invention relates to the field of self-service terminals, in particular to a telescopic device, a telescopic high-speed photographic apparatus and self-service equipment. The telescopic device comprises a fixing frame, a first telescopic frame, a second telescopic frame and a first driving assembly. The first driving assembly can drive the first telescopic frame to retract relative to the fixed frame and drive the second telescopic frame to synchronously retract under the effect of a connecting piece, and can also drive the second telescopic frame to retract relative to the first telescopic frame, so that the telescopic device is in a retracting state, and the size of the telescopic device in the retracting state can be reduced. An image collector of the telescopic high-speed photographic apparatus is arranged on the second telescopic frame of the telescopic device, the first telescopic frame can retract relative to the fixing frame, and the second telescopic frame can retract relative to the first telescopic frame, so that the image collector is stored in the fixing frame, and the size of the telescopic high-speed photographic apparatus in a retracting state can be reduced. Asthe size of the telescopic high-speed photographic apparatus in the retracted state is reduced, the size of the cabinet of the self-service equipment provided with the telescopic high-speed photographic apparatus can be reduced.

technical field [0001] The invention relates to the field of self-service terminals, in particular to a telescopic device, a telescopic high-speed camera and self-service equipment. Background technique [0002] Banks, social security and other self-service equipment usually have an image acquisition mechanism for scanning and archiving the documents that need to be submitted for handling business. In conventional self-service equipment, for the convenience of installation and use, the image acquisition mechanism is usually installed outside the self-service equipment and connected with it. The shell of the self-service device is fixedly connected; however, such a setting makes the image acquisition mechanism still located outside the self-service device when it is in a non-working state, which is easy to be accidentally touched, has certain potential safety hazards, and is not convenient for transportation.
